gpt4 book ai didi

javascript - 使用javascript编辑带有嵌入式PHP的html

转载 作者:行者123 更新时间:2023-11-30 22:37:35 26 4
gpt4 key购买 nike

希望有人能帮我解答

我目前正在尝试为我的商店网站创建一个 PHP 产品页面,我有一个存储图像前缀名称的 sql 表,例如,如果图像文件是“test_1.png”,那么该表将存储“test”。使用嵌入式 php

src="images/shop/<?php echo $row['item_img'], '_1.png';?>"></img>

我想做的是使用 js,在单击鼠标时动态更新 src。

类似的东西。

var imgSwitch = function(i){
Document.getElementById('js-img').src = "images/shop/
<?php echo $row['item_img'], '_';?>i<?php echo '.png';?>";
}

即使对我来说这似乎是错误的,这就是为什么我在这里求助于 GURU

这有可能吗?如果没有,任何建议将不胜感激

最佳答案

我想弄清楚你在问什么,我认为这是你要走的路:

var imgSwitch = function(i){
document.getElementById('js-img').src = "images/shop/<?php echo $row['item_img'], '_';?>" + i + ".png";
}

变化在i,你必须把字符串剪下来,然后把它作为一个变量来添加。

但是请记住,PHP 代码是在服务器上执行的,一旦页面发送到客户端就不会改变。当您执行该函数时,$row['item_img'] 将始终相同。

关于javascript - 使用javascript编辑带有嵌入式PHP的html,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32036683/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com